Assaulting me!  The darkness comes to be
    in devil’s guise. Phantom haunts my mind;
  in sleep paralysis I cannot flee -
insanity bleeding through ruined rind.

I’m humbled now and at your merciless
  whims and words afflicting by your whipping
    cruelty I’d endured and what of this -
      stranglehold of fear that is so gripping.

      The trauma it inflicts does overwhelm
    in present as it did in madness past,
  as Hypnos slips me blackened nightmare’s realm
my sanity becomes a lone outcast.

Stalking specter and there’s no protections,
  I’m the victim with my mind in confines,
    house of mirrors broken your reflections;
      antagonistic mania still shines.

      My life with you; you’re still inside my head,
    though self-destruction chose as your fare-well.
  Subconsciously you infiltrate with dread
as incubus revenge becomes my Hell.


Susan Ashley
September 23, 2018


*Hypnos: the ancient Greek god of sleep*

Premium Member Phantasmagoria

Dark shadows cast by trees at night-
   as wind gives life to limbs that scare,
so oft can stir such inner fright.
   Dark shadows cast by trees at night   
morph images- let thoughts incite
   unwanted feelings of despair;
dark shadows cast by trees at night-
   as wind gives life to limbs that scare.

The mind plays games and creates fear,
   as tree-limb shadows writhe around
like eerie snakes, entwined, austere.
   The mind plays games and creates fear,
while courage fades- truths disappear.
   As steady moonbeams sweep the ground,
the mind plays games and creates fear-
   as tree-limb shadows writhe around.

Premium Member Phantasmagoria

Projected on to a large screen
The gruesome shape of evil’s face
A haunting form from Halloween.
Projected on to a large screen
A lantern cheats – don’t intervene
To stop the nightly ghoul’s forays
Projected on to a large screen
The gruesome shape of evil’s face.
